Output e851c83c831336615959cef752a67579c6453b366c1d9e6e5af582e91b17f26a:0

value
39090229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b398b623c44f9e9da0153646f4e02f177a0da06 OP_EQUAL
address
MSRiLdaXhsiWvwnbgAii2ffyTNsqakPzdU
transaction
e851c83c831336615959cef752a67579c6453b366c1d9e6e5af582e91b17f26a
spent
true